Invitrogen™ ABAT Polyclonal Antibody

Description
Positive Control: mouse brain, rat brain Predicted reactivity: Mouse (100%), Rat (100%). Store product as a concentrated solution. Centrifuge briefly prior to opening the vial.
Specifications
Specifications
| Antigen | ABAT |
| Applications |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in), Western Blot |
| Classification | Polyclonal |
| Concentration | 1 mg/mL |
| Conjugate | Unconjugated |
| Formulation | PBS with 20% glycerol and 0.025% ProClin 300; pH 7 |
| Gene | ABAT |
| Gene Accession No. | P50554, P61922 |
